WebCapitalize Seasons When Used as Part of a Proper Noun If you use a season name as part of a proper noun, you must also capitalize it. Generally, this is done when describing an event specific to a season. For example: The 2024 Summer Olympics The Fall Classic The 2024 Winter Season Ski Jumping Championships boston college gabelli scholarshipWebAre seasons capitalized?
